SPIEGEL, District Judge.
George Vaughan, the debtor, appeals a district court order holding that payments which he made to corporate creditors pursuant to a guaranty agreement are deductible as nonbusiness bad debts, 26 U.S.C. § 166(d), rather than as losses incurred in a transaction entered into for profit, though not connected with a trade or business, 26 U.S.C. § 165(c)(2).
